> > i googeled so much, but can't find the answer, so hopefully somebody can 
> > tell me, if it is possible to install foreman smart proxy via foreman 
> > puppets. My problem: I provisioned a new ubuntu host via foreman 
> > (bootdisk) in another subnet. Now i would like to install foreman-proxy 
> > on this host, but not via apt. I found foreman-proxy on puppetlabs, i 
> > downloaded and installed it on the foreman server. I deployed the 
> > foreman_proxy class on the target machine, after that I get an error in 
> > the reports: 
> > 
> > " 
> > Could not retrieve catalog from remote server: Error 500 on SERVER: 
> > {"message":"Server Error: Evaluation Error: Error while evaluating a 
> > Resource Statement, Evaluation Error: Error while evaluating a Function 
> > Call, Permission denied - 
> > /opt/puppetlabs/puppet/cache/foreman_cache_data/oauth_consumer_key 
> > " 
>
> This is a permissions issue, try running a "chown -R puppet 
> /opt/puppetlabs/puppet/cache/foreman_cache_data" to reclaim the 
> directory. Later versions of Puppet Server and Foreman should fix this 
> by separating the cachedir between apply/master mode.
